Dental coverage, offered through Aetna, is designed to promote good dental health for you and your eligible dependents. You automatically receive dental coverage if you are enrolled in medical coverage.
As a represented employee, you are eligible for coverage on your date of hire. Review the Dental Expense Plan Summary Plan Description (SPD) for details.
If you are eligible for coverage under more than one dental plan — for example, if your spouse can cover you under his or her employer’s plan — it may not mean that you will receive more benefits. Most plans coordinate benefits, meaning your total benefit is limited to what you would receive under the plan with the highest coverage level. For more information on how coordination of benefits works, review the Dental Expense Plan SPD or contact the carrier.

Changing Your Dental Plan Option
Once you are enrolled in the Traditional option, you may switch to the DMO (if it is available to you). You may switch back and forth between the Traditional option and DMO option at any time, but not more than once a month. To switch, call Aetna directly at:
If you call by the 15th of the month, your change will become effective on the 1st of the following month.
